Why Kinect is ever so wide!
The end result is an array of four downward-facing (so that the front of Kinect stays clean and grill-free) mics, spaced one on the left and three on the right. In fact, this specific microphone placement is the only reason why Kinect is as wide as it is.

The motor:
When you get your hands on Kinect, you might notice that the base is quite weighty. While this is in part to stop the unit from falling over, it’s also due to the motor being located there. It’s able to move the unit’s head up and down, plus or minus 30 degrees, meaning that (when placed at the optimal 3-6ft height) it can still work regardless of your TV unit’s height.
